"Ibis Ambassador Seoul Insadong Hotel is one of the best non-luxury hotels I've ever stayed at. Rooms are extremely clean, the bed is soft by Asian standards, breakfast and lunch buffets are generous for the price point, and facilities are modern. Ibis cuts cost in ways that don't impact the stay much: there are no disposable toiletries (there is a shampoo/body wash dispenser in the shower) but you can buy a toothbursh, razor, etc for a reasonable price. There's no mini bar, but you still get a fridge in the room. Porters do not carry luggage to your room, but there are luggage carts available. Service is oriented towards self-resolution. For example, when asked to book a taxi, front desk staff wrote down the name of our destination in Korean and instructed us to hail a cab outside, which proved easy enough. When we asked more general questions or had issues with facilities (a safe with low batteries), staff responded quickly and comprehensively. Notably, laundry machines let you wash or dry your clothes for KRW 1,000/load, which is very competitive. There are also hot/cold/warm water dispensing machines on each floor, so there's no need to get bottled water. The rooms were wonderfully cosy. They were not large, but there was enough room for a desk, closet, shelving, and a bench. My companion and I both slept unusually well while staying here. Finally, the location is fantastic. A short walk to 2 different train stations and to Insadong street, this Ibis is central, surrounded by restaurants, and easy to find. "

"First , you may need to tell the taxi driver that you are heading to hotel Ramada ( the old name ) , they don't know that the hotel had changed its name to Atrium . The staffs are very polite and helpful . Front desk speaks 3 languages - Korean ( native ) , mandarin (fluent) and English (comprehensive ) . They are handsome and pretty too (no joke) I did not expect the room to be so comfortable at this rate . I booked a king size standard room at about 300 USD for 4 nights .(breakfast is EXCLUDED) They have electrical sockets cater US / UK and Korean . Air condition , TV and lighting are synchronized under one remote controller . The hotel is literally 5 minutes away from subway (Jongno 5(Wu) ga), for line number 1. Line 1 brings you to quite a number of tourist attractions like Insadong , city hall , gwanhwamun , and hongdae . Dongdaemun (fashion hub of Seoul) is 15 minutes walk to the east and gyeongbokgung( the joseon palace) is 20 min walk to the west . I had a great stay in the hotel , as a tourist and would recommend for those who - travel in small group - have some budget for comfortable but not luxurious trip "

Step Back in Time with Jongro’s Historical Treasures

Jongro is rich in history, with numerous historical treasures that tell the story of Seoul's past. A visit to Bukchon Hanok Village is a must, as it showcases traditional Korean houses, known as hanoks, that date back to the Joseon Dynasty. Walking through the narrow alleyways, visitors can admire the beautiful architecture and learn about the lifestyle of the people who once lived there. Many of the hanoks have been converted into guesthouses, tea houses, and cultural centers, offering a glimpse into the past while providing modern amenities.

Another significant site is the Changdeokgung Palace Complex, a UNESCO World Heritage site renowned for its stunning architecture and beautiful gardens. The palace is an excellent representation of the harmony between nature and human creations. Guided tours are available, allowing visitors to delve into the rich history of the palace and its royal inhabitants. Don't miss the Secret Garden, an enchanting area filled with lush greenery, ponds, and pavilions, perfect for a peaceful escape.

The Jongmyo Shrine is another historical gem that honors the kings and queens of the Joseon Dynasty. This shrine is famous for its Confucian rituals and ceremonies that have been performed for centuries. The serene atmosphere and beautiful architecture make it a great spot for reflection and appreciation of Korea's cultural heritage. Each of these historical sites in Jongro provides a unique glimpse into the past, making it an enriching experience for visitors eager to learn about Korea's history.

Festivals and Events that Celebrate Jongro’s Culture

Jongro is alive with festivals and events that celebrate its rich cultural heritage throughout the year. One of the most popular events is the Seoul Lantern Festival, held annually along the Cheonggyecheon Stream. This enchanting festival features thousands of beautifully crafted lanterns that illuminate the night, creating a magical atmosphere. Visitors can stroll along the stream, admiring the artistic displays and enjoying food stalls offering local delicacies.

Another exciting event is the Jongmyo Daeje, a traditional ritual ceremony held at the Jongmyo Shrine. This event is a UNESCO-recognized cultural heritage that honors the spirits of the Joseon Dynasty kings and queens through music, dance, and offerings. Attending this ceremony provides a unique insight into Korea's historical customs and is a profound experience for those interested in the nation’s traditions.

Throughout the year, Jongro also hosts various art exhibitions, performances, and street festivals that showcase local talent and creativity. From traditional music performances to contemporary art showcases, there is always something happening in the district. Engaging with these cultural events not only enhances your experience in Jongro but also allows for a deeper appreciation of the vibrant community spirit that thrives in this area.

Practical Information for Your Jongro Journey

Before heading to Jongro, it’s helpful to gather some practical information to ensure a smooth trip. The local currency is the South Korean won (KRW), and it’s advisable to have some cash on hand for small purchases, especially at street vendors and local shops. ATMs are widely available, and most major credit cards are accepted at hotels and larger establishments.

Language can be a barrier, but many locals in Jongro speak basic English, especially in tourist areas. Learning a few simple Korean phrases can enhance your interactions and show respect for the local culture. Phrases like “안녕하세요” (annyeonghaseyo - hello) and “감사합니다” (gamsahamnida - thank you) are appreciated by residents and can make your experience more enjoyable.

Health and safety are also important considerations. Seoul is generally safe for travelers, but it’s always wise to stay vigilant, especially in crowded areas. Make sure to have travel insurance that covers medical emergencies, and familiarize yourself with local medical facilities in case of any health issues. With these practical tips in mind, you’re well-prepared for an amazing adventure in Jongro.
